Spencer Perlman has joined lobbying firm Washington Strategic Consulting as a vice president
May 17th, 2007 - Congress Daily

Spencer Perlman, legislative director for former Rep. John Porter, R-Ill., when Porter chaired the House Labor-HHS Appropriations Subcommittee, has joined lobbying firm Washington Strategic Consulting as a vice president. Since leaving Capitol Hill in 2001, Perlman worked as a legislative affairs manager at Ungaretti & Harris and as government relations director at Drinker Biddle & Reath. He has represented various healthcare and biotech interests, including Advocate Health Care, the Iowa Department of Public Health, and the National Association for Home Care and Hospice.
